dignified

/ˈdɪɡnɪfaɪd/ · adjective

Meaning

  1. Having an attitude or bearing that connotes respectability and poise.
  2. To invest with dignity or honour.
  3. To give distinction to.
  4. To exalt in rank.
  5. (chiefly in the negative) To treat as worthy or acceptable; to indulge or condone by acknowledging.
